*Despite open government’s best intentions to prioritise collaboration, 
government bodies consistently duplicate each other’s effort. 
Collaborating as effectively as open communities is much harder than 
you’d think.*

*

A number of us “open technologists” have drafted a paper describing the 
challenges government faces, along with our vision for how to address 
these. It is being presented as part of Australia’s updated Open 
Government National Action Plan. … more
